Hi Nicole,
First I wanted to thank you for your previous answer. It was very helpful. I'm learning how to work with symptoms and use them for taking my process further.

Now I had a few days in which I had low fever, I didn't have any other inflammation signs but decided for a few days to do the elemental diet. I'm not sure what the fever was caused by but it seems like its getting back to normal.

I started craniosacral therapy a few weeks ago, generally I felt much better but the wounded place in my stomach got stiffer. I'm not sure why. It is not painful at all but I can feel it more then before. I though it might be a reaction to the treatment. I can't explain it but although it feels stiffer, I feel that craniosacral is really good for me. I would love to hear your opinion about that.

I started the Oregano oil protocol two days ago. I started with 1 drop 3 times a day and I'm increasing the dose gradually. I was worried as my stomach is very sensitive to herbs but it seems like its going well.
I'm taking aloe vera juice twice a day, morning and evening and I am not sure how long after the oregano oil I can take the aloe vera in the morning.

I'm doing castor oil packs and I think it makes my elimination softer and sometimes floating. I wanted to know if you know anything about it.

Is there anything else you could recommend me to do at this point?

Hi, FNG.

Sorry I've been awhile responding to you!

I want to make sure that you are taking probiotics in addition to the oil of oregano.

I'd mention that you're feeling stiffer in that spot to the craniosacral therapist. He/she may be able to release that specific area.

In all honesty, I've never used castor oil packs personally; so I can't really comment on it. Taken internally, it certainly could cause loose or soft stools, so given that the skin can absorb nutrients, chemicals, etc., it does make some intuitive sense that it could loosen your stools. Castor oil packs have a good record for softening scar tissue, however.
